Summary

May is Mental Health Awareness Month, highlighting the challenges engineers face with on-call duties and the resulting stress, burnout, and high turnover rates. Organizations report significant financial losses due to unsustainable operations, with more than two-thirds losing over $300,000 per downtime hour. Implementing sustainable operations involves reducing cognitive load, eliminating manual toil, and integrating AI to improve operational resilience, work-life balance, and on-call rotations. PagerDuty offers solutions such as intelligent scheduling, virtual responders, and unified workflows to enhance efficiency and reduce anxiety. A crucial element is fostering a blameless culture that promotes psychological safety and open communication about mental health. Organizations are urged to take steps towards sustainable operations to enhance team well-being and maintain a competitive edge, with 95% of leaders acknowledging the competitive advantage of faster incident recovery.
